#7bc702 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bc702 is composed of 48.2% red, 78%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 99%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 83.1 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 39.4%. #7bc702 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ff04 with #008f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#7bc702 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bc702 has RGB values of R:123, G:199,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 8111874.

Shades and Tints of #7bc702
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030500 is the darkest color, while #f9fff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7bc702
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666a5f is the less saturated color, while #7bc702 is the most saturated one.
